Understanding Electroplating Barrels: Core Features and Functions

Electroplating barrels are designed specifically for the electroplating process, where a metal layer is deposited onto a substrate to enhance its properties. These barrels facilitate the effective and uniform coating of multiple components, ranging from automotive parts to delicate electronic components. Key features of electroplating barrels include:

  • Material Composition: Typically made from high-strength, corrosion-resistant materials such as polyethylene or polypropylene, these barrels withstand harsh chemical environments.

  • Design Variability: The barrels come in various sizes and designs to accommodate different shapes and loads, ensuring optimal spacing and arrangement of parts for uniform electroplating.

  • Rotation Mechanism: A rotating mechanism allows for even distribution of the electroplating solution, reducing dead zones and ensuring consistent coverage.

  • Compliance with Industry Standards: Many electroplating barrels meet stringent industry standards such as ISO 9001 and RoHS, guaranteeing quality and environmental safety.

Main Advantages and Application Scenarios

One of the standout advantages of using electroplating barrels is their ability to enhance operational efficiency. By enabling the electroplating of multiple items simultaneously, these barrels reduce processing time and costs. They are particularly beneficial in high-volume production environments, such as automotive manufacturing or electronic component production.

Furthermore, the barrels help minimize the use of plating solutions and chemicals through their design, thus promoting sustainability. The reduction in waste not only lowers material costs but also aligns with modern demands for eco-friendly manufacturing practices.
